How Vamana treatment for Psoriasis can be beneficial
Psoriasis is a common yet chronic skin disease that accelerates the life cycle of skin cells and causes a buildup of cells on the skin. They form scales and red patches, which are itchy, irritating, and painful. Psoriasis is thought to be an immune system problem where overactive T cells attack healthy skin cells by mistake.

Vamana Treatment for Psoriasis in Ayurveda
To treat psoriasis, Ayurveda uses a holistic treatment options, one such being Vamana. Simply put, Vamana is therapeutic vomiting i.e. medically induced vomiting. To start with, an internal oleation is performed before getting ready for purification. In Vamana, internal oleation or Snehapana is performed by giving light food with warm ghee. Vamana, which is a part of Panchkarma treatment, flushes out toxins from the body and strengthen the immune system. Hence, it can be beneficial to treat psoriasis.
